Output d84c996871c058bde728d0da9ee151784439f7b62e735b0f30c4fa39df18fba5:0

value
16000
script pubkey
OP_0 OP_PUSHBYTES_20 f7c9decd81c23d7aee2df787cae68a7a42ebc94b
address
bc1q7lyaanvpcg7h4m3d77ru4e520fpwhj2twdvumg
transaction
d84c996871c058bde728d0da9ee151784439f7b62e735b0f30c4fa39df18fba5
confirmations
190152
spent
true